The ext filesystems take locality into + // condsideration, i.e. data blocks of a file will tend to be placed close + // together. On a spinning disk, locality reduces the amount of movement of + // the head hence speeding up IO operations. On an SSD there are no moving + // parts but locality increases the size of each transer request. Hence, + // having mutual exclusion on the read seeker while reading a file *should* + // help in achieving the intended performance gains. + // + // Note: This synchronization was not coupled with the ReadSeeker itself + // because we want to synchronize across read/seek operations for the + // performance gains mentioned above.
